Output 7d21853fb50b7f6367aca26e0b6a12a535f9205b8ec0fa3bb4cfd553ca54aac6:0

value
592662834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ed7912678587d58ed3b090a7049e236f846d6c1 OP_EQUAL
address
MF63BFU2sSCcADttu96eTxSjPwM9RCPmZi
transaction
7d21853fb50b7f6367aca26e0b6a12a535f9205b8ec0fa3bb4cfd553ca54aac6
spent
true